Lockport Man Faces Federal Charges After Border Inspection at Lewiston Bridge. Authorities arrested a 37-year-old Lockport resident after a border investigation at the Lewiston–Queenston Bridge revealed drugs, cash, and a loaded firearm. The individual faces federal charges including possession with intent to distribute cocaine and carrying a firearm related to drug trafficking. Law enforcement seized multiple substances, money, and a revolver. The suspect, already on parole for a prior weapons conviction, remains detained following a court hearing. Mary Lou Young, Former Rye Community Volunteer, Dies at Age 96. Mary Lou Young, a longtime Rye resident and dedicated community volunteer, died on December 7, 2025, at the age of 96 in Vero Beach, Florida. Raised in Wilson, New York, and educated at Syracuse University, Young settled in Rye with her family in 1960. She played active roles in local organizations such as Christ’s Church, the Rye Garden Club, and the Twig Organization, and also served on the boards of United Hospital and The Osborn. Eagles Edge Bills 13-12 at Highmark Stadium. The Philadelphia Eagles secured a narrow 13-12 win over the Buffalo Bills at Highmark Stadium. Josh Allen led all passers with 262 yards through the air, while James Cook III rushed for 74 yards and Brandin Cooks posted 101 receiving yards. The game was witnessed by 71,105 fans.
